Description
The PRWT12-2DO is an M12 cylindrical inductive proximity sensor with 2 mm sensing range, dual transistor output (NO+NC), and weld-resistant construction. The combination of weld resistance and complementary dual output provides both protection in welding environments and output flexibility for control logic implementation without additional sensors or relay inversion in robotic welding cell fixture monitoring.
